CZ-4C R/B is risking orbital collision with IRIDIUM 33 DEB. The time of closest approach (TCA) between the two objects is calculated to be at Nov. 21, 2024, 7:09 p.m., with a collision probability of 0.060%. The closest distance at TCA is estimated to be 349.0 meters.
